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ress Specifics

Milliard Bedding uses CertiPUR-US certified foams only, which is as good as an industry standard by now. However, there’s a distinct lack of a clearly stated GREENGUARD Gold certification! This is the first crib mattress we’ve reviewed without one.

What’s in a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ress?

The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ress has one of the most uncomplicated interiors we’ve seen: a 5.5-inch thick solid block of Milliard foam.

This material is then encased in a fiberglass-lined fire sock, before it’s encased in a removable mattress cover.

The non-removable fire retardant measure doesn’t use any harmful chemicals, and it’s also one of the most effective. It’s compliant with all federal flammability safety regulations, too. Note, though, that fiberglass-based flame barriers may also suffer from poor durability in the long run.

What Is the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ress Cover Made From?

The crib mattress cover is made from polyester and thermoplastic polyurethene (TPU) undercoating. 

The polyester-based mattress cover also features a fun polka dotted print, and it both zip removable and waterproof. The fit is not very snug, so it is normal to notice a little rippling of fabric.

What Is Thermoplastic Polyurethane (TPU)?

TPU is an elastomer—a polymer with elastic properties—which is very flexible and adaptable, making it a popular material to use in dozens of manufacturing industries.

It makes for the undercoating of a crib mattress cover to be made from th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U). After all, it is what’s often used for waterproof parts of diaper covers, too.

What Can Be Used with the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ress?

US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) regulations regarding crib mattresses are clear. The length and width must be 27.25 inches by 51.25 inches at the very least, and the thickness 6 inches at the most.

The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ress sits perfectly within these requirements: 27.5 inches wide and 52 inches long, 5.5 inches thick. This means that any standard size crib, fitted sheet or mattress protector should be compatible with it.

Not sure of the size of your crib? Perform the two finger test and check for too much space between the crib and the mattress. If you find that the gap is too wide, either the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ress being used is defective or the crib is not of standard size.

In any case, a failed two finger test means that the two products aren’t compatible. Using both of them in tandem may pose a danger to your little one! Change one of the two to keep your child safe.

How Do You Set Up the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ress?

Talk about a compact product! Most crib mattresses that you can order online come in frustration-free cardboard boxes. The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ress is no different, but you might the small size of the box may confuse you. This crib mattress is shipped like most regular-sized foam mattresses. It’s compressed, vacuum sealed and rolled up.

To set it up, remove from packaging and lay it flat on a surface in a warm and well ventilated area for two to three days. This allows it to decompress fully and gives the new mattress smell time to dissipate. Some negative reviews note that it took weeks for the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ress to air our completely, though.

If that the smell is particularly strong, try removing the cover and airing out the foam and cover as separate items. This may speed up the process, and it also allows you to inspect the mattress cover for possible defects.

How Do You Clean the Milliard Crib and Toddler Bed Mattress?

Setup is painless, but maintenance is another issue. Cleaning difficulties are some of the most common complaints in the customer feedback we combed through.

Remember that removable mattress cover? It’s said to be washable on top of responding well to spot cleaning, but that’s not the same as machine washable. It just means that you can immerse it in water and completely soak it before hang drying.

If you throw the mattress cover in a washing machine, the waterproof TPU coating may flake and make a mess of things. We’ve also seen customer complaints of flaking happening even before the first cleaning! There are accounts of the defect being discovered only upon the first time the cover is unzipped.

While most of the feedback of this kind were very negative, some did contain a silver lining. Those that did contact Milliard Bedding directly about the issue received prompt responses. Cover replacements were sent, with the explanation being that the defective covers might have come from older stock.

Does Milliard Bedding Offer a Sleep Trial, Return Policy and Warranty?

There is a return policy that comes with a 30-day money-back guarantee.

Holding on to an unused item and want to return it for a full refund? You can within 30 days of purchase—not delivery—with no questions asked. In these cases, though, it’s expected for customers to shoulder return shipment costs.

Returning an item because of manufacturing defects or damage incurred during shipping? Refunds will be issued for both full item price and return shipping costs. Just remember to keep the original packaging, as you need to return those as well in case you want to avail of the guarantee.

We also recommend checking the waterproof backing of the mattress cover immediately! Keeping an eye on how it performs in the first month of use, too. It’s the weak point of the product, and the part that’s likely to need replacement.

While there is a guarantee, there is no warranty—as far as we can tell. It’s not mentioned anywhere on the official website. This is disappointing, but also not unexpected considering the price point.
